由於對再生能源和永續產品的需求不斷增長,清潔技術市場預計在預測期內將以 17.1% 的複合年增長率穩步增長。清潔技術市場的主要驅動力是緩解氣候變遷和減少溫室氣體排放的迫切需求。各國政府和國際組織正在製定雄心勃勃的碳減排和再生能源部署目標,並創造支持清潔技術發展的監管環境。技術進步也使清潔技術更有效率、更具成本效益,使其成為傳統化石燃料的可行替代品。消費者對永續產品的意識和需求也不斷增加,鼓勵企業採用和投資清潔技術解決方案。稅收抵免和補貼等財政激勵措施進一步鼓勵企業和個人轉向清潔能源和更有效率的技術。

太陽能產業的快速擴張就是清潔技術市場成長的一個例子。Enphase Energy 等公司處於該行業的前沿,提供先進的基於微型逆變器的太陽能和電池系統,以提高能源效率和可靠性。Enphase Energy 最近收購了 SolarLeadFactory,這是一家為太陽能安裝商提供高品質銷售線索的公司,目標是增加銷售線索量和轉換率,並降低安裝商的客戶獲取成本。此舉說明了策略收購和技術進步如何推動清潔技術市場的發展,實現再生能源解決方案的廣泛採用,並為整體永續發展目標做出貢獻。

依產品類型劃分,清潔技術市場分為生物燃料、電動車、綠色材料、回收服務、智慧電網 IT 服務和太陽能服務。電動車和太陽能服務產業預計在預測期內將呈現顯著成長。政府的激勵和支持政策是電動車(EV)和太陽能市場的主要動力。世界各國政府正在實施各種措施來鼓勵電動車的採用,包括稅收抵免、補貼以及對製造商和購買者的激勵措施,以幫助提高電動車的價格。同樣,太陽能市場受益於稅收抵免、回扣和上網電價補貼等政策,這些政策鼓勵住宅和商業用途採用太陽能光電系統。技術進步也發揮關鍵作用,不斷的創新使電動車更有效率且價格實惠,太陽能技術更有效率且更具成本效益。此外,消費者對環境問題的認識不斷提高以及對永續能源解決方案的渴望進一步推動了對電動車和太陽能的需求。支持政策、技術進步和消費者需求的綜合影響正在推動這些市場的顯著成長。

清潔技術市場依應用細分為工業、運輸、製造、公用事業、化學、電子、農業等。預計汽車和工業領域在預測期內將呈現顯著成長。工業和汽車行業在很大程度上是由自動化程度的提高和智慧技術的整合所推動的。在工業領域,物聯網 (IoT)、人工智慧 (AI) 和機器人技術等工業 4.0 技術的採用正在提高效率、生產力和安全性。這些技術可實現即時監控、預測性維護和優化運營,從而降低成本並提高競爭力。在汽車領域,向電動車 (EV) 和自動駕駛技術的轉變是主要驅動力。消費者對更清潔、更有效率的交通選擇的需求,加上更嚴格的排放法規和政府激勵措施,正在加速電動車的開發和採用。此外,電池技術的進步、充電基礎設施的改進以及車輛連接和自動駕駛系統的創新正在改變汽車產業,使其更具永續性和技術先進。

為了更瞭解清潔技術產業的市場採用情況,市場分為北美(美國、加拿大、北美其他地區)、歐洲(德國、英國、法國、西班牙、義大利、歐洲其他地區)、亞太地區(中國、日本)、印度、澳洲、亞太地區其他地區)以及世界其他地區。由於快速的城市化、工業化和經濟發展,亞太地區 (APAC) 的清潔技術市場正在經歷顯著成長。該地區各國政府實施了支持性政策和監管框架,以加速清潔技術的採用。中國、印度和日本等國家正大力投資再生能源項目,特別是太陽能和風能,以滿足日益增長的能源需求,同時減少碳排放。此外,消費者和企業環保意識的增強,加上再生能源技術的技術進步和成本下降,正在推動亞太地區清潔技術市場的成長。對電動車、節能解決方案和永續基礎設施不斷增長的需求進一步促進了市場擴張,使亞太地區成為全球邁向永續未來的關鍵參與者。

The cleantech market is a rapidly expanding sector focused on technologies and solutions that reduce environmental impact and improve resource efficiency. This market spans a broad range of industries, including renewable energy (solar, wind, and hydropower), energy efficiency, electric vehicles, smart grids, and sustainable agriculture. With growing global awareness of climate change and environmental sustainability, the demand for clean technologies is increasing significantly. Governments worldwide are implementing policies and incentives to promote the adoption of cleantech solutions, further driving the market's growth. Investment from both private and public sectors continues to flow into the development and deployment of innovative technologies, positioning the cleantech market as a key player in the transition to a sustainable future.

The Cleantech Market is expected to grow at a robust CAGR of 17.1% during the forecast period, owing to the rising demand for renewable energy and sustainable products. The primary driver of the cleantech market is the urgent need to mitigate climate change and reduce greenhouse gas emissions. Governments and international organizations are setting ambitious targets for carbon reduction and renewable energy adoption, creating a supportive regulatory environment for cleantech development. Advances in technology have also made clean technologies more efficient and cost-effective, making them viable alternatives to traditional fossil fuels. Consumer awareness and demand for sustainable products are also rising, pushing companies to adopt and invest in cleantech solutions. Financial incentives, such as tax credits and subsidies, further encourage businesses and individuals to switch to cleaner energy and more efficient technologies.

An example of the cleantech market's growth can be seen in the rapid expansion of the solar energy sector. Companies like Enphase Energy are at the forefront of this industry, offering advanced microinverter-based solar and battery systems that enhance energy efficiency and reliability. Enphase Energy's recent acquisition of SolarLeadFactory, a company providing high-quality leads to solar installers, aims to increase lead volumes and conversion rates, thereby driving down customer acquisition costs for installers. This move exemplifies how strategic acquisitions and technological advancements are propelling the cleantech market forward, enabling broader adoption of renewable energy solutions and contributing to the overall sustainability goals.

Based on Product Type, the Cleantech market is segmented into Biofuels, Electric Vehicles, Green Materials, Recycling Services, Smart Grid IT Services, and Solar Services. The EV and Solar Services segment is expected to showcase a substantial growth rate during the forecast period. Government incentives and supportive policies are significant drivers for both the electric vehicle (EV) and solar markets. Governments worldwide are implementing various measures to promote the adoption of EVs, including tax credits, subsidies, and incentives for manufacturers and buyers, which help reduce the upfront costs and make EVs more affordable. Similarly, the solar energy market benefits from policies such as tax credits, rebates, and feed-in tariffs, encouraging both residential and commercial adoption of solar power systems. Technological advancements also play a crucial role, with ongoing innovations making EVs more efficient and affordable, and solar technologies more efficient and cost-effective. Additionally, increasing consumer awareness of environmental issues and the desire for sustainable energy solutions further drive the demand for both EVs and solar energy. The combined impact of supportive policies, technological progress, and consumer demand is propelling significant growth in these markets.

Based on Application, the Cleantech market is divided into Industrial, Transportation, Manufacturing, Utilities, Chemicals, Electronics, Agriculture, and Others. The Automotive and Industrial segment is expected to showcase a substantial growth rate during the forecast period. The industrial and automotive segments are significantly driven by advancements in automation and the integration of smart technologies. In the industrial sector, the adoption of Industry 4.0 technologies, including the Internet of Things (IoT), artificial intelligence (AI), and robotics, enhances efficiency, productivity, and safety. These technologies enable real-time monitoring, predictive maintenance, and optimized operations, leading to cost savings and increased competitiveness. In the automotive segment, the shift towards electric vehicles (EVs) and autonomous driving technologies is a major driver. Consumer demand for cleaner, more efficient transportation options, coupled with stringent emissions regulations and government incentives, accelerates the development and adoption of EVs. Additionally, advancements in battery technology, improved charging infrastructure, and innovations in vehicle connectivity and autonomous driving systems are transforming the automotive industry, making it more sustainable and technologically advanced.

For a better understanding of the market adoption of the Cleantech industry, the market is analyzed based on its worldwide presence in countries such as North America (U.S.A., Canada, and Rest of North America), Europe (Germany, United Kingdom, France, Spain, Italy, and Rest of Europe), Asia-Pacific (China, Japan, India, Australia, and Rest of Asia-Pacific), Rest of World. The Asia-Pacific (APAC) region is experiencing significant growth in the cleantech market, driven by rapid urbanization, industrialization, and economic development. Governments in the region are implementing supportive policies and regulatory frameworks to promote the adoption of clean technologies. Countries such as China, India, and Japan are investing heavily in renewable energy projects, particularly solar and wind power, to meet their increasing energy demands while reducing carbon emissions. Additionally, rising environmental awareness among consumers and businesses, coupled with technological advancements and declining costs of renewable energy technologies, are propelling the growth of the cleantech market in the APAC region. The increasing demand for electric vehicles, energy-efficient solutions, and sustainable infrastructure further contributes to the market's expansion, positioning the APAC region as a key player in the global transition towards a sustainable future.
